Gretchen Decker Obituary

Gretchen Renee Decker, age 47, of Little York, Illinois, died at 1:21 PM on Thursday, June 13, 2019 in Henry County, Illinois as a result of a traffic accident. She was born on December 22, 1971 in Furth, Germany, the daughter of Russell "Rusty" and Sandra K. (Bridgman) Decker. 

Gretchen attended school in the Union School District and was a graduate of Union High School with the Class of 1990. After school, she proudly served her Country in the United States Air Force for 4 years. When Gretchen's service was complete, she attended Western Illinois University where she graduated with a degree in Law Enforcement. During her college years, she worked at the Good Hope Convenience Store, Beck's Convenience Store, and Shopko both in Monmouth. Currently, Gretchen was a meter reader for Donco Electrical Services. 

Gretchen loved all animals and had many "Fur Babies" of her own. She worked many hours with animal rescue and especially Western Illinois Animal Rescue in Monmouth, Illinois. Gretchen also enjoyed fishing, auctions, and finding that unique antique. 

She is survived by her father, Russell "Rusty" Decker of Gladstone, Illinois; her brother, Russell (Amanda) Decker, Jr. of Galesburg, Illinois; one niece, Jade Decker; three nephews, Tanner (Sara) Decker, Trace (Sydney) Decker, and Drake Decker; one step-sister, Dawn (John) Legier or Makanda, Illinois; and her step-grandfather, Ed Ronner of Gladstone, Illinois. A number of other relatives are also surviving. She is preceded in death by her mother, Sandra Decker, maternal and paternal grandparents, one aunt, and several uncles.

A funeral service is planned for 1:30 PM on Wednesday, June 19, 2019 at Turnbull Funeral Home in Oquawka, Illinois. Her family will be present to greet friends at a visitation from 5:00-7:00 PM on Tuesday, June 18, 2019 also at the funeral home. Interment with Military Honors will be in the Oquawka Cemetery after the Wednesday service. Memorial can be left to the family or Western Illinois Animal Rescue in Monmouth.
